TP won't answer calls
 
Forgive me ahead of time if there is a topic on this. Tried numerous searches with no love.

Recently, my phone has started this annoying habit where the Answer soft button does not work when someone is calling me. Nor does the hard button work to answer a call.

It is a a big pain in the *** and everyone thinks I am ignoring them since I have to call them back. I haven't installed anything lately, but I have been tethering more, which is the only real change.

Any ideas on what's going on and how to fix it? ](*,)

shockerengr 03-20-2009 01:21 PM

Re: TP won't answer calls
 
diamond tweak or advanced config changed a reg setting on ya. the data connection resume is goofed and won't let you answer calls

from the TP essentials sticky:

"Issues with answering your phone when a data connection is open (answer buttons don't do anything)? Looks like a tweak messes up a registry key that affects this. [H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\Comm\ConnMgr\Planner\Settings], make sure SuspendResume is set to #777 (not anything containing GPRS). This issue seems to be related to Advanced Config. source"
